Background:
Cytosolic malate dehydrogenase (MDHC or cMDH) is an important NAD-dependent enzyme involved in glycometabolism that catalyzes the formation of oxaloacetate and NADH from L-malate and NAD. MDHC is highly expressed in brain, heart and skeletal muscle and plays a role in aerobic energy production for muscle contraction, transmission of neuronal signals, absorption/ resorption pathways, collagen-supporting functions, dead cell phagocytosis, as well as pathways involved in gas exchange and cell division. Furthermore, MDHC is a regulatory subunit of the nucleic acid-conducting channel (NACh). MDHC functions as a homodimer and is highly conserved in plants, animals and bacteria. The activity of MDHC is controlled by the sesquiterpenoid juvenile hormone (JH) and the steroid hormone ecdysone.
Alternative Name:
Malate dehydrogenase, cytoplasmic, Cytosolic malate dehydrogenase, Diiodophenylpyruvate reductase, MDHA, MDHC, cMDH
Application Dilution: WB: 1:500~1:1000
Specificity: MDH1 polyclonal antibody detects endogenous levels of MDH1 protein.
Immunogen:
A synthetic peptide corresponding to residues in Human MDH1.
MW: ~ 36 kDa
Swis Prot.: P40925
Purification & Purity:
The antibody was affinity-purified from rabbit antiserum by affinity-chromatography using epitope-specific immunogen and the purity is > 95% (by SDS-PAGE).
Format:
1mg/ml in PBS with 0.1% Sodium Azide, 50% Glycerol.
Storage:
Store at 4°C short term. Aliquot and store at -20°C long term. Avoid freeze-thaw cycles.
